For
anyone who has longed to experience the flavour and challenge of
a Himalayan mountaineering expedition but without the time and expense
usually involved, a Trekking Peak is a viable alternative.
A trekking peak expedition starts with a walk into the base camp,
during which time you acclimatise and build up fitness. Depending
on your choice of peak, time is spent preparing for the climb and
assuring that everybody is properly acclimatised before you embark
on your summit attempt. Our experienced climbing Sirdars and Sherpa
team are among the best in Nepal and will make sure your climb is
a safe and enjoyable challenge.
